Solution Overview
Problem
Disposable medicament delivery devices pose challenges in incorporating reusable recording units due to cost and environmental concerns, and the risk of misplaced recording units leading to incorrect adherence monitoring.
Innovation Solution
A holder with attachment elements for securely storing and retrieving reusable recording units, featuring interfaces matching those of medicament delivery devices, and an optional electronic circuit for user communication and data monitoring, allowing secure attachment to various surfaces and facilitating easy retrieval.
Engineering Contradictions & Design Principles
Engineering Contradiction Analysis
1Reliability
If a recording unit is integrated with a disposable medicament delivery device, then monitoring of medicament delivery is achieved, but cost increases and environmental impact worsens due to disposal of electronic equipment
Solution Approach 1:
The system is divided into two separate components: a disposable medicament delivery device and a reusable recording unit. The recording unit can be detached and reused across multiple devices, eliminating the need to dispose of electronic components with each single-use device, thereby reducing electronic waste while maintaining monitoring functionality.
Solution Approach 2:
The recording unit is designed as a universal component that can be attached to multiple disposable medicament delivery devices. This multi-functional design allows a single recording unit to serve numerous delivery devices over time, reducing the frequency of disposal and lowering overall electronic waste generation.
2Loss of substance
If a recording unit is made reusable and stored between uses, then cost and environmental impact are improved, but the risk of misplacement increases leading to incorrect adherence monitoring
Solution Approach 1:
A holder serves as an intermediary storage solution between the recording unit and the user. The holder provides a designated, visible location for storing the recording unit when not in use, reducing the likelihood of misplacement or forgetfulness while maintaining the reusable nature of the recording unit.
Solution Approach 2:
The holder or recording unit may incorporate visual indicators such as color changes or distinctive markings to signal the status or location of the recording unit, making it easier to locate and reducing the risk of misplacement that could compromise monitoring reliability.
3Strength
If attachment elements provide strong holding force, then the recording unit is securely stored, but the ease of retrieval may be reduced
Solution Approach 1:
The attachment mechanism incorporates dynamic characteristics that allow it to adapt between strong holding and easy release. The attachment elements are designed to provide firm holding during storage while enabling simple, tool-free removal when needed, balancing security with ease of operation.

The present invention relates to a holder (150) for a recording unit (50), which recording unit (50) is arranged with an interface configured to cooperate with an interface of a medicament delivery device for obtaining information regarding the use of the medicament delivery device, the holder (150) comprising an interface (158) configured to cooperate with the interface of the recording unit, and the holder (150) further comprising attachment elements (156) for attaching the holder to a suitable surface.
